Photographer’s Note
Well, this is from a trip to Woodlands, in Texas. The tower is called "Anadarko Tower", and the arch that is also seen is from a walk around a river that runs thru the city.
This picture reminds me a funny moment of the trip, because I needed to lay down in the floor to take it, and all the people who were passing thru kept looking at me like if I was kind of weird or psycho or something like that. Anyways, it's worthy =)
